Revamped Tournament Structure

The WTT Press Conference unveiled a significantly revamped tournament structure designed to elevate the sport's global appeal and competitiveness. These changes directly impact player participation, prize money, and the overall excitement of the professional table tennis circuit.

Increased Prize Money & Player Rankings

The most impactful change announced at the WTT Press Conference is a substantial increase in prize money. This strategic move aims to attract the world's top talent and foster a more competitive environment.

  • Specific numbers: Prize money has increased by 40%, with the total prize pool exceeding $100 million across the revamped WTT calendar.
  • New Ranking System: A new, more dynamic ranking system will be implemented, factoring in performance across various WTT events. This ensures qualification for major tournaments is based on consistent high-level play. The new system emphasizes recent performance more heavily, offering opportunities for rising stars.
  • Tournaments Affected: The restructuring will particularly affect the WTT Champions Series, WTT Star Contender series, and the WTT Grand Smash events, increasing their prestige and attracting even bigger names.

New Tournament Formats & Innovations

The WTT Press Conference also highlighted exciting innovations in tournament formats designed to enhance fan engagement and create more dynamic matches.

  • New Formats: Shorter match formats, incorporating best-of-five games instead of best-of-seven in some instances, are aimed at maximizing excitement and shortening match durations without sacrificing the quality of play. A new team-based competition format, similar to other popular team sports, is also being introduced to increase team spirit and rivalries.
  • WTT Official Quotes: "These changes are designed to make table tennis more accessible and engaging for a broader audience," stated a WTT spokesperson at the press conference. "We believe these innovative formats will attract new fans while enhancing the viewing experience for existing ones."
  • Impact on Fan Engagement: The shorter match formats and the team-based competition are expected to dramatically improve fan engagement, attracting a younger demographic and increasing viewership on streaming platforms.

Enhanced Media Coverage & Fan Engagement

The WTT Press Conference underscored the organization's commitment to expanding its reach and building a stronger connection with fans worldwide. This involves significant investments in media partnerships and innovative digital strategies.

Expanded Broadcasting Partnerships

The WTT has secured several new broadcasting partnerships to extend its global reach and increase viewership.

  • New Broadcast Partners: New deals with major sports broadcasters in key markets such as Europe, Asia, and North America will significantly boost the visibility of WTT events. Specific names of partners will be announced soon.
  • Global Viewership Impact: These partnerships are projected to increase global viewership by at least 50% over the next two years. The aim is to make WTT events must-see viewing across all major television and streaming platforms.
  • Streaming Platforms: The WTT will also leverage popular streaming platforms to reach younger audiences and provide global access to live matches and on-demand content.

Digital Marketing & Social Media Initiatives

The WTT Press Conference detailed a comprehensive digital marketing and social media strategy to engage with fans on a more personal level.

  • Social Media Initiatives: The WTT will be launching interactive social media campaigns, including live Q&As with players, behind-the-scenes content, and fan contests to foster a stronger sense of community.
  • Influencer Marketing: They plan to collaborate with relevant sports influencers and personalities to promote WTT events and reach a wider audience.
  • Impact on Fan Growth: These efforts are expected to significantly increase fan engagement, brand awareness, and attract new, younger fans to the sport.
